Clerx
Best for: Solo attorneys and small-to-midsize immigration law firms looking for a cost-effective, plug-and-play AI receptionist with proven integration into legal tech stacks and strong multilingual support.
Clerx offers a specialized AI receptionist solution designed specifically for law firms, with a strong focus on immigration practice needs. According to their website, Clerx’s AI receptionist, named Donna, handles every client call 24/7, answering in English and Spanish, qualifying leads, and scheduling consultations. The platform integrates directly with major legal practice management systems like Clio, PracticePanther, and MyCase, ensuring seamless data flow without manual entry. It is praised for its ability to handle high call volumes, with testimonials from immigration attorneys confirming it captures thousands of calls monthly. The AI is trained to manage sensitive intake conversations with empathy, making clients feel heard even during late-night or weekend inquiries. A key strength is its proven ROI, with firms reporting a 2-5x increase in paid consultations and a 10x return on investment compared to traditional call centers. The service is marketed as a 'full-time AI receptionist' that eliminates the need for hiring or training staff, freeing up legal teams to focus on high-value work. Pricing is transparent, with a flat monthly fee for unlimited calls.

Intellivizz
Best for: Immigration law firms that need a straightforward, affordable AI receptionist with strong multilingual capabilities and automated reminders, without the complexity of deep technical customization.
Intellivizz offers an AI receptionist service tailored for professional services, including immigration law firms. According to their website, their solution provides 24/7 call handling, consultation scheduling, multilingual support in seven languages (English, German, French, Spanish, Portuguese, Italian, Dutch), and automated reminders for appointments. The platform is designed to enhance client support and case management by ensuring every call is answered professionally, regardless of the time zone. It handles case intake assistance, gathering essential client details before appointments, and provides instant responses to common immigration-related FAQs. The service is marketed as a scalable solution suitable for both solo practitioners and large firms. It is positioned as a way to improve client experience and reduce no-shows through automated reminders. The pricing is straightforward, with a one-time setup fee and a monthly subscription, and the platform emphasizes security for handling sensitive client information.
